They have great turkish dishes in an absolutely great surrounding. They have a great terrace for sitting outside, too.
You can smoke Shisha in here and smoking is allowed in almost the whole restaurant. For non-smokings there is a cute seperate space.
In the evenings the restaurant is full so if you want to have dinner here I suggest to make a reservation.
Favorite Dish: Meze Tabaklari - a variation of turkish starters. This dish is large so you don´t even need a main course.

Its choice of food is changing, but it's always fresh and healthy. Unless other German types of food it is always prepared with less salt and fat. The location of the restaurant is ideal for city travellers, on the short walk from market square to the castle it is just in front of the latter. Although a prominent address it is slightly hidden behind large trees, thus giving it a rather insider feeling in comparison to the neighbouring Café Residenz. Due to its more than reasonable prices and choices for people with only a little hunger it is popular with the local students.
Apart from being a mere restaurant it also provides galery spaces with changing exhibitions and bed & breakfast in the adjacent building.
For people interested in history, Johann Wolgang Goethe was living in this house from 1776-1777.

This restaurant calls itself an Italian ice cream place, but on their menu they offer much
more. They have a large selection of cakes and waffles. We ordered some waffles, thinking it would be a small snack. When they were brought to our table, we realized this was no small in-between meal, but a full lunch.
You can choose among various toppings. My daughter had the applesauce and I ordered a waffle sandwich. It was filled with a light "quark" - a sort of yoghurt -, plus whipped cream on the side and vanilla ice cream. Fantastic. A good coffee to go with it and we had a wonderful rest, sitting outside and watching people go by.
Around noon, when we arrived, we could choose our table, but it soon got very busy. It seems to be a very popular place.
